All the love stories we have ever heard are testament to this truth: Romeo and Juliet, Lailā and Majnu, Rādhā and Kṛṣṇa. Nothing could stop Rādhā from being with Kṛṣṇa – not shame, not criticism, not even the Yamuna River in full flood. Because where there is love there is no fear. And where there is no fear, we become free.But unfortunately, most of us do not live in love, we only fall in love. To fall in love is easy, but to live in love from moment-to-moment requires us to love that which is true and permanent; to love God.Make an effort to build a personal relationship with God. At the least, discover the strength of faith to believe that God has sent you here to fulfill a special purpose. If you are unable to fulfill that purpose, then He has to; let Him do it. This attitude will allow you to live in love..Give your love to the Highest: do everything for His sake and let Him work through you..The highest duty of all human beings is to know the Truth, to realise the essential Self. To discover your highest nature is your ultimate purpose in life; anything that opposes that purpose cannot claim your allegiance. When your vāsanās (tendencies) and likes and dislikes throw obstacles in your way, free yourself from conflict and confusion through selfless action and steadfast adherence to duty.Approach your duty with decisiveness and conviction. Work with commitment and devotion; develop the discipline that ensures cooperation both from others and your own inner personalities.And remember that no duty is arduous or difficult if your motivation is love. Give your love to the Highest: do everything for His sake and let Him work through you. Then all success and all failure belong only to Him, and you will be free to storm the world with love.
